Output 266f724b10c07f74a8a1d314a2e2f5c11038e34e9324e4cee25f32b57fb4664e:1

value
432656
script pubkey
OP_0 OP_PUSHBYTES_20 74589257c28635fb7132106a816febc52625814f
address
bc1qw3vfy47zsc6lkufjzp4gzmltc5nztq203sluy9
transaction
266f724b10c07f74a8a1d314a2e2f5c11038e34e9324e4cee25f32b57fb4664e
confirmations
235806
spent
true